My Windows computer cannot identify the connected HUAWEI MateView GT as an audio input device
Applicable products:
My Windows computer cannot identify the connected HUAWEI MateView GT as an audio input device |
Problem
Under Choose your input device, the message No input devices found displays, along with the prompt USB device not recognized.
Cause
- There is a USB compatibility issue.
- The driver is faulty.
Solution
- Scenario 1: If the microphone has been working properly, but fails to be identified after the computer is powered off and then on, try the following:
- Remove and re-insert the power adapter to the monitor.
- Press the five-way joystick upward and hold for at least 3 seconds to power off the monitor, then press the five-way joystick upward to power it on. Check whether the problem is resolved.

- Scenario 2: If the microphone cannot be identified when you power on the device for the first time, perform the following:
- Use a standard USB-C to USB-C/USB-A to USB-C/HDMI/DP cable, and reconnect the cable between the computer and the monitor.
- Remove and re-insert the power adapter to the monitor.
- Press the five-way joystick upward and hold for at least 3 seconds to power off the monitor, then press the five-way joystick upward to power it on. Check whether the problem is resolved.
- Check whether the Windows version is the latest: Search for Update in the Windows search box and click Check for updates. If You're up to date is displayed, no update is required. Otherwise, use the update tool provided by Microsoft to automatically obtain the updates. For details, visit https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/software-download/windows10 for Windows 10 and https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/software-download/windows11 for Windows 11.
- Update the audio driver using either of the following methods:
- Press Win+X to open Device Manager, right-click Audio inputs and outputs, and click Scan for hardware changes.
- Press Win+X to open Device Manager, click Audio inputs and outputs, right-click the microphone, and click Update driver for the system to automatically search for drivers. If the audio driver is running the latest version, use DriverGenius or LDS Benchmark to update the driver.
